summaryrefslogtreecommitdiff
path: root/profiles/prefix
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2021-02-13 21:41:11 +0000
committerV3n3RiX <venerix@redcorelinux.org>2021-02-13 21:41:11 +0000
commitc8d60dada2ec8eb48b2d2b290cd6683ccec40e39 (patch)
treec44943ee0563a3fa957716de909fed683117fcb9 /profiles/prefix
parent69051588e2f955485fe5d45d45e616bc60a2de57 (diff)
gentoo (valentine's day) resync : 14.02.2021
Diffstat (limited to 'profiles/prefix')
-rw-r--r--profiles/prefix/darwin/macos/11.0/arm64/gcc/eapi1
-rw-r--r--profiles/prefix/darwin/macos/11.0/arm64/gcc/package.accept_keywords5
-rw-r--r--profiles/prefix/darwin/macos/11.0/arm64/gcc/parent2
-rw-r--r--profiles/prefix/darwin/macos/11.0/arm64/gcc/use.mask5
-rw-r--r--profiles/prefix/darwin/macos/package.mask5
-rw-r--r--profiles/prefix/darwin/package.use.mask4
-rw-r--r--profiles/prefix/packages3
7 files changed, 14 insertions, 11 deletions
diff --git a/profiles/prefix/darwin/macos/11.0/arm64/gcc/eapi b/profiles/prefix/darwin/macos/11.0/arm64/gcc/eapi
new file mode 100644
index 000000000000..7ed6ff82de6b
--- /dev/null
+++ b/profiles/prefix/darwin/macos/11.0/arm64/gcc/eapi
@@ -0,0 +1 @@
+5
diff --git a/profiles/prefix/darwin/macos/11.0/arm64/gcc/package.accept_keywords b/profiles/prefix/darwin/macos/11.0/arm64/gcc/package.accept_keywords
new file mode 100644
index 000000000000..bd43de88a9a0
--- /dev/null
+++ b/profiles/prefix/darwin/macos/11.0/arm64/gcc/package.accept_keywords
@@ -0,0 +1,5 @@
+# Copyright 1999-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+# Apple SI support only exists in Ians' WIP
+=sys-devel/gcc-11* **
diff --git a/profiles/prefix/darwin/macos/11.0/arm64/gcc/parent b/profiles/prefix/darwin/macos/11.0/arm64/gcc/parent
new file mode 100644
index 000000000000..fceecddb55c7
--- /dev/null
+++ b/profiles/prefix/darwin/macos/11.0/arm64/gcc/parent
@@ -0,0 +1,2 @@
+..
+../../../features/fsf-gcc-ld64
diff --git a/profiles/prefix/darwin/macos/11.0/arm64/gcc/use.mask b/profiles/prefix/darwin/macos/11.0/arm64/gcc/use.mask
new file mode 100644
index 000000000000..da062601beda
--- /dev/null
+++ b/profiles/prefix/darwin/macos/11.0/arm64/gcc/use.mask
@@ -0,0 +1,5 @@
+# Copyright 1999-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+# SSP seems to cause asm/assembly errors with GCC, so disable it
+ssp
diff --git a/profiles/prefix/darwin/macos/package.mask b/profiles/prefix/darwin/macos/package.mask
index 99f21f91b1f5..b06b52c76822 100644
--- a/profiles/prefix/darwin/macos/package.mask
+++ b/profiles/prefix/darwin/macos/package.mask
@@ -6,8 +6,3 @@
# gnulib/malloc/dynarray-skeleton.c
=net-misc/wget-1.21.1
=sys-apps/findutils-4.8.0
-
-# Fabian Groffen <grobian@gentoo.org> (2020-11-23)
-# no symbols from libopenbsd-compat
-=net-misc/openssh-8.3_p1-r5
-=net-misc/openssh-8.4_p1-r2
diff --git a/profiles/prefix/darwin/package.use.mask b/profiles/prefix/darwin/package.use.mask
index e99219cedba4..eb3e4c4d1487 100644
--- a/profiles/prefix/darwin/package.use.mask
+++ b/profiles/prefix/darwin/package.use.mask
@@ -17,10 +17,6 @@ net-misc/mosh utempter
# Avoid pulling in broken and unnecessary ossp-uuid, bug #324527
dev-db/postgresql uuid
-# Christoph Junghans <junghans@gentoo.org> (2012-08-26)
-# libutempter support does not work on Darwin (bug #388791)
-x11-terms/eterm utempter
-
# Fabian Groffen <grobian@gentoo.org> (2012-03-24)
# There's no upstream support for MPI on Darwin
media-gfx/tachyon mpi
diff --git a/profiles/prefix/packages b/profiles/prefix/packages
index bec16c0399b0..03d33255d151 100644
--- a/profiles/prefix/packages
+++ b/profiles/prefix/packages
@@ -1,4 +1,4 @@
-# Copyright 1999-2020 Gentoo Authors
+# Copyright 1999-2021 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
# Prefix does not need busybox for emergency recovery,
@@ -7,7 +7,6 @@
# Man pages are not essential.
-*sys-apps/man-pages
--*virtual/man
# A service manager is not essential.
-*virtual/service-manager